如何更换过期的SSL证书?

要更换过期的SSL证书,请重新生成CSR(证书签名请求),向CA(证书颁发机构)申请新证书并安装。

SSL证书是保护网站安全的重要组成部分,它能在客户端和服务器之间建立数据传输加密通道,防止数据在传输过程中被泄露、劫持和窃听,SSL证书也有有效期限,当SSL证书到期时,您需要及时更换它,以确保网站的安全性和可信度,以下是更换过期的SSL证书的步骤:

如何更换过期的SSL证书?

1、了解SSL证书的有效期限

SSL证书的有效期为一年或更长时间,具体取决于您购买证书时选择的期限。

您可以通过查看证书的详细信息或与证书颁发机构(CA)联系来确定证书的到期日期。

2、选择新的SSL证书

一旦您确认了证书的到期日期,下一步是选择新的SSL证书。

您可以选择续订当前证书,或者购买一个新的证书。

如果您选择续订当前证书,您需要联系证书颁发机构,并按照他们的指示进行续订。

如果您选择购买新的证书,您可以选择与当前证书相同的证书类型,或者根据需要选择其他类型的证书。

3、生成证书签名请求(CSR)

无论您是续订当前证书还是购买新的证书,您都需要生成一个证书签名请求(CSR)。

CSR是一个包含您的网站信息的文件,用于向证书颁发机构申请新的SSL证书。

您可以使用SSL证书管理工具或命令行工具生成CSR。

在生成CSR时,确保提供准确的网站信息,包括域名、组织名称和联系信息。

4、购买或续订SSL证书

如何更换过期的SSL证书?

一旦您生成了CSR,下一步是购买或续订SSL证书。

您可以选择与当前证书颁发机构继续合作,或者选择其他可信的证书颁发机构。

根据您的需求选择合适的证书,并按照证书颁发机构的指示进行购买或续订。

5、安装新的SSL证书

获得了新证书后,将新申请的SSL证书安装到Web应用服务器上。

登录数字证书管理服务控制台,访问个人测试证书(原免费测试证书)页签的个人测试证书(原免费版pro)页签。

提交证书申请,具体操作请参见申请个人测试证书。

证书签发后,将新申请的SSL证书安装到Web应用服务器上。

6、测试SSL证书的安装

安装完新的SSL证书后,应立即通过浏览器访问您的网站,确认URL已显示为“https”开头,并显示安全锁标志,表示新证书已成功安装并生效。

可以使用在线SSL证书检查工具进行验证,以确保新的证书已经正确安装并且可以正常工作。

7、更新网站配置和链接

确保网站的URL和外部链接都更新为HTTPS格式,以便访问者能够通过安全的连接访问您的网站。

如果有任何资源或页面指向旧的HTTP地址,请将其更新为HTTPS。

如何更换过期的SSL证书?

8、备份新证书和私钥

为了防止未来再次发生证书丢失或损坏的情况,建议备份新的SSL证书文件和对应的私钥。

9、监控证书状态

为了确保网站安全,建议定期监控证书的状态,并在证书接近过期之前提前进行更新或续费。

10、考虑自动化管理

对于拥有大量证书的企业来说,依靠手动管理可能会增加运维压力,因此建议采用自动化管理系统来降低证书运维压力。

以下是两个相关问题与回答栏目:

Q1: 如果我的电脑系统时间不正确,会导致SSL证书过期吗?

A1: 是的,如果电脑系统的时间不正确,可能会导致SSL证书显示为过期,在这种情况下,您需要将电脑系统的时间调整至SSL证书有效期之内。

Q2: 如果我的网站外链的SSL证书过期了怎么办?

A2: 如果当前站点外链网站的SSL证书过期了,需要网站所有者撤销外链或者外链网站所有者到CA机构替换或续费证书。

小伙伴们,上文介绍了“SSL证书过期怎么更换新证书?”的内容,你了解清楚吗?希望对你有所帮助,任何问题可以给我留言,让我们下期再见吧。

原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/1161013.html

本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。

(0)
未希新媒体运营
上一篇 2024-10-05 19:57
下一篇 2024-10-05 19:57

相关推荐

  • 如何修改服务器密码?

    修改服务器密码通常需要管理员权限,通过ssh或控制台登录后,使用passwd命令更改当前用户密码,或用sudo passwd更改其他用户的密码。

    2024-12-29
    06
  • 如何使用Feign在域名访问时处理SSL证书问题?

    在Spring Cloud中,使用Feign客户端访问带有SSL证书的HTTPS域名时,需要确保Feign客户端信任目标服务器的SSL证书。这涉及到配置Feign客户端使用自定义的TrustManager或SSLContext来绕过或接受特定的SSL证书验证。以下是一段关于如何实现这一配置的简要回答:,,1. **获取并导入SSL证书**:从可信赖的CA机构(如阿里云、华为云等)获取SSL证书,并将其导入到项目中的密钥库中。,,2. **配置Feign客户端**:在Spring Cloud应用中,通过Java代码配置Feign客户端,使其使用自定义的TrustManager或SSLContext。这可以通过实现Client接口来完成,该接口允许你定义如何创建和配置用于HTTP请求的客户端实例。,,3. **示例代码**:以下是一个简化的示例代码片段,展示了如何在Spring Cloud应用中配置Feign客户端以接受特定的SSL证书:, “java, @Bean, public Client sslClient() throws Exception {, // 加载SSL证书, String certContent = … // 从文件或其他来源加载证书内容, InputStre…am = new ByteArrayInputStream(certContent.getBytes());, CertificateFactory cf = CertificateFactory.getInstance(“X.509”);, X509Certificate certificate = (X509Certificate) cf.generateCertificate(is);,, // 创建默认的信任管理器,并添加证书到信任列表中, TrustManager[] trustAllCerts = new TrustManager[]{, new X509TrustManager() {, public java.security.cert.X509Certificate[] getAcceptedIssuers() {, return null;, }, public void checkClientTrusted(X509Certificate[] certs, String authType) {, // 省略具体的证书链验证逻辑, }, public void checkServerTrusted(X509Certificate[] certs, String authType) {, // 省略具体的证书链验证逻辑, }, }, };,, SSLContext sc = SSLContext.getInstance(“TLS”);, sc.init(null, trustAllCerts, new java.security.SecureRandom());, return new Client.Default(sc.getSocketFactory(), new NoopHostnameVerifier());, }, `, 上述代码中的证书加载和信任管理器配置仅为示例,实际应用中可能需要根据具体情况进行调整和完善。特别是,直接使用TrustManager`绕过所有证书验证可能会带来安全风险,应谨慎处理。,,在Spring Cloud中使用Feign访问带有SSL证书的HTTPS域名时,关键在于正确配置Feign客户端以信任目标服务器的SSL证书。这通常涉及到加载证书、配置TrustManager以及可能的其他安全设置。

    2024-12-28
    05
  • 如何进行个人域名注册并添加SSL解析?

    个人域名注册后,可通过服务商配置SSL证书,实现https加密访问,保障数据传输安全。

    2024-12-27
    011
  • 如何更改服务器密码?

    服务器密码更改通常在控制面板或设置中的安全选项里进行。

    2024-12-27
    011

发表回复

您的电子邮箱地址不会被公开。 必填项已用 * 标注

产品购买 QQ咨询 微信咨询 SEO优化
分享本页
返回顶部
云产品限时秒杀。精选云产品高防服务器,20M大带宽限量抢购 >>点击进入